Juliana Carpenter 1583–1663 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 7 Mar 1583

Birth Location: Wrington, Somerset, England

Death Date: 19 Feb 1663

Death Location: Plymouth, Plymouth, Massachusetts, United States

Father: Alexander Carpenter

Mother: Priscilla Dillon

Spouse(s): George Morton, Manasseh Kempton

Children(s): George Morton, Sarah Morton, Nathaniel Morton, Patience Morton, John Morton, Alice MORTON, Ruth Morton, Joseph Morton, Ephraim Morton

The story of Juliana Carpenter began in 1583 in Wrington, Somerset, England. Juliana Carpenter married George Morton, Manasseh Kempton, and had children including Alice Morton, Ephraim Morton, George Morton, John Morton, Joseph Morton, Nathaniel Morton, Patience Morton, Ruth Sarah Morton, Sarah Morton. Juliana Carpenter passed away in 1663 in Plymouth, Plymouth, Massachusetts, United States.
